Gift Aid

If you pay UK tax and let us know, the government will give UWC Atlantic 25% on top of your donation. It won't cost you a penny.

Read More

More Gift Aid Information


Please notify UWC Atlantic if you:
  • Want to cancel this declaration.
  • Change your name or home address.
  • No longer pay sufficient tax on your income and/or capital gains.

If you pay income tax at the higher rate or additional rate and want to receive the additional tax relief due to you, you must include all your Gift Aid donations on your Self Assessment tax return or ask HM Revenue and Customs to adjust your tax code.
